## Deployment

Before rolling out Querden 4.2, note the query planner regression introduced in 4.1: joins against the `shipments_archive` table may choose a sequential scan under high statistics skew. We pinned the planner heuristics to the 4.0 behavior until the Marstow team ships a fix. Deploy with the canary group first, watch p95 latency on the planner stage for at least twenty minutes, and roll back immediately if it doubles. The pinned planner settings we deploy with are listed below.

settings of fafog-haduf:
ZORIX_PIN=4648
ZORIX_METRICS_HOST=metrics.zorix.paliqsys.corp
ZORIX_LOG_LEVEL=info
ZORIX_TENANT=druix

## Autocomplete Index: Why It's Slow (and the knobs)

Quick context for the security review: the Fernwick autocomplete index rebuilds nightly, and lookups fan out across shards with a per-query budget. Nothing user-supplied touches the rebuild path — inputs are sanitized at the Copperline gateway. The slowness comes from overly cautious throttles we added after last quarter's incident. The throttle values under review are these.

tuning table, yajog-yahof:
BUDGETS = {
    "lamvan": 303,
    "wenox": 460,
    "fenvan": 525,
}

## Configuration

The legacy Quillbase ORM layer is mid-refactor. New repositories use the Veldt mapper; old ones still read `orm.legacy.yml`. Do not mix the two in one transaction — the session caches diverge. Connection pooling is configured per-service in `config/pools.toml`. Migrations run through `veldt migrate` only. The mapper authenticates to the schema registry with a service credential, set in your env file on the line below.

secret setting of hawep-yahig: LEDGER_TOKEN29=41b5d6315371c92885eaeb077fb63

**Vendor note: Inkmill markdown pipeline**

Rendering for Parchway docs is outsourced to Inkmill under an annual contract, renewing each March. They handle sanitization and PDF export; we own the upload queue. SLA: 4-hour response on rendering failures. Escalate only after two failed retries. Their support desk is reachable at the address below.

billing contact of hahaf-baguf = zorael.tammir.jorius@sivrelhq.internal